As we age, our bodies undergo a variety of changes, and one of the most common concerns many face is joint health. Joints can become stiffer and less mobile due to wear and tear, making everyday movements more challenging. However, there are natural solutions that can support aging joints, helping to improve mobility and overall quality of life.
The first step towards maintaining joint health is to focus on nutrition. Many people are unaware that the food we consume plays a crucial role in how our joints feel. A diet rich in anti-inflammatory foods can be incredibly beneficial. Incorporating fruits and vegetables such as berries, spinach, and kale, which are high in antioxidants, can help combat inflammation. Omega-3 fatty acids, found in fatty fish like salmon and plant sources like flaxseed, also have anti-inflammatory properties that can help reduce joint pain.
Another natural solution is to stay well-hydrated. The cartilage in our joints needs moisture to stay healthy, and dehydration can lead to decreased lubrication, resulting in more discomfort and stiffness. Drinking enough water throughout the day not only helps support joint health but is also essential for overall bodily functions.
Exercise is another key component to maintaining healthy joints. While it may seem counterintuitive for those experiencing joint pain, gentle movement can actually strengthen the muscles around the joints and improve flexibility. Low-impact exercises such as swimming, cycling, or walking are excellent choices. Strength training can also be useful, but it’s important to focus on proper form and to work with a trainer if you’re uncertain about how to proceed safely.
In addition to diet and exercise, supplements may offer further support. Glucosamine and chondroitin are two popular supplements known to aid joint health by promoting cartilage repair and reducing pain. Collagen supplements are also becoming increasingly recognized for their benefits in maintaining joint integrity and mobility. Herbs and natural remedies can also offer relief. Turmeric contains curcumin, a compound known for its potent anti-inflammatory properties. Adding turmeric to your diet or taking it in supplement form may help reduce joint pain. Ginger is another herb that has been shown to have anti-inflammatory effects and can be easily incorporated into meals or taken as a tea.
Mindfulness and stress management techniques should not be overlooked when considering joint health. Chronic stress can lead to inflammation and increased pain perception. Practices such as yoga, meditation, or deep-breathing exercises can help mitigate stress and promote relaxation, ultimately benefiting your overall health.
Finally, maintaining a healthy weight is vital for joint support. Excess weight puts additional strain on weight-bearing joints like the knees and hips, leading to increased pain and potential degeneration over time. Engaging in weight management strategies through a balanced diet and physical activity can make a significant difference in joint health.
